> Not too long ago there were some reports about SMB signing being very
> costly. Signing would give approximately 500 MB/s, while encryption
> would give closer to 1200 MB/s. Signing is controlled by Security
> Settings -> Local Policies -> Security options "Microsoft network
> client: Digitally Sign Communications (always)".

>> I have just notices some possible performance issues on SMB when using CES, at least compared to NFS. Using NFSv4 I can easily get 1 GB/s on a single client (linux), while when using a CIFS mount I get tops 500 MB/s on a single client. Using two separate servers as clients gets a 1 GB/s total throughput on the CES server, so I would say there not a strict limitation on the CES server itself. Any hints on how to improve this / debugging hints? I spent some time on IBM documentation and some user groups talks, but got no improvement...
